REGISTRATION GUIDELINES FOR ADDRESSING THE PLANNING AND ZONING
COMMISSION
Individuals may speak during a Planning and Zoning Commission meeting under one of the following categories:
Comments on Agenda Items:
Public comments can be given for any item considered by the Planning and Zoning Commission, EXCEPT
work session reports or closed meetings. Individuals are only able to comment one time per agenda item
and cannot use more than one method to comment on a single agenda item. Public comments are limited to
three (3) minutes per citizen.
Public Hearing Items:
Individuals are limited to four (4) minutes per public hearing item.
_________________________________________________________________________________
Individuals may participate by using one of the following methods:
1. In Person for Regular or Consent Agenda Items:
To provide in-person comments regular or consent agenda items (excluding public hearing items),
Individuals must be present at the meeting and submit a speaker card (available at the meeting location) to
the Secretary prior to the item being called.
2. In Person for Public Hearing Items:
For public hearing items, speaker cards are encouraged but not required.
3. eComment:
The agenda is posted online at https://tx-denton.civicplus.com/242/Public-Meetings-Agendas. Once the
agenda is posted, a link to make virtual comments using the eComment module will be made available next
to the meeting listing on the Upcoming Events Calendar. Using eComment, Individuals may indicate
support or opposition and submit a brief comment about a specific agenda item. eComments may be
submitted up until the start of the meeting at which time the ability to make an eComment will be closed.
eComments will be sent directly to members of the Planning and Zoning Commission immediately upon
submission and recorded by the Secretary into the Minutes of the Meeting.

This notice authorizes the Planning and Zoning Commission to recommend and City Council to approve a
different zoning district which is equivalent to or more restrictive than that which is requested by the
Page 4 Printed on 10/8/2024
Planning and Zoning Commission Meeting Agenda October 9, 2024
applicant, as the different district may not have a maximum structure height, floor area ratio, or density that is
higher than the one requested or be nonresidential when the request is for a residential use or vice versa. The
different zoning district must be deemed consistent with the Comprehensive Plan and the Future Land Use
Plan.
